I had a thread before of my compression test and when i did it, i didn't pull my injectors or held it at wide open throttle but was at operating temp. The results from cyl 4 to 1 were 180psi, 175psi, 170psi, and 160psi. I redid my test today at operating temp, wideopen throttle, adn injectors pulled. I got from cyl 4 to 1 200psi, 200psi, 195psi, and 190psi. The result seems way better and what it should be. the car is a 2000 civic si 69k mi, w/ b16a2. Are my new results good and normal????
